WebApr 5, 2024 · Weight Transfer Drill. Proper weight transfer is essential for generating power and hitting a golf ball higher with a driver. To practice weight transfer, place a towel or club on the ground behind the ball. On your downswing, try to transfer your weight onto your left foot and hit the towel or club. WebIncreasing Distance. Kirk Triplett, Professional PGA Champions Golfer in 2024. If you want to learn how to hit the driver farther, you need to focus on speed and consistency of contact. Striking the golf ball in the center of the driver gets you more yards. You get even more yards if you can strike the ball with more speed.
